The Northwestern Israel Innovation Project and the Chicago Festival of Israeli Cinema present “Israel Behind the Scenes” featuring award-winning Israeli filmmaker Barak Heymann LIVE. The October 7 attack has traumatized both Israelis and Palestinians. It also holds the potential for inevitable and much-needed change. During Barak’s program, he will share the painful reality in which he lives and what he believes is needed for this turbulent war to give way to a better and more humane future. Through this talk, Barak interweaves select clips of films and television series, like Bridge Over the Wadi (2006), Almost Friends (2014), Comrade Dov (2019), and a new yet unfinished documentary, all of which touch on issues and layers that make the Israeli reality so complex – conflicted and racist, but at the same time full of potential, activism and hope. 

Barak Heymann has been directing and producing documentaries for TV and cinema for more than 20 years. Heymann Brothers Films, the independent film company led by Barak and his brother Tomer, has produced over 30 documentaries, some as international co-productions. Their films have premiered in numerous festivals worldwide, such as Berlinale, IDFA, and Hot Docs, where they have won prestigious awards.
